Nitro PDF Pro for Windows 14.41.1.4 contains a heap use-after-free vulnerability in the implementation of the JavaScript method this.mailDoc().

Nitro PDF Pro for Windows 14.41.1.4 contains a heap use-after-free vulnerability in the implementation of the JavaScript method this.mailDoc(). During execution, an internal XID object is allocated and then freed prematurely, after which the freed pointer is still passed into UI and logging helper functions. Because the freed memory region may contain unpredictable heap data or remnants of attacker-controlled JavaScript strings, downstream routines such as wcscmp() may process invalid or stale pointers. This can result in access violations and non-deterministic crashes.

CVE-2023-6448
Default Admin Password in Unitronics Vision PLC and HMI (VisiLogic < 9.9.00)

Unitronics VisiLogic software before version 9.9.00, which runs on Vision and Samba PLCs and HMIs, ships with a default administrative password that many deployments never change. An unauthenticated attacker with network access to the device can authenticate with these default credentials, requiring no exploit development or user interaction. A successful login grants full administrative control of the PLC/HMI, allowing the attacker to modify configuration and program logic and potentially disrupt the physical process (such as water treatment and distribution) the device controls. Any deployment of the listed Unitronics Vision models (and, per CISA's description, Samba devices) running VisiLogic prior to 9.9.00 is affected, with the greatest risk for units directly exposed to the internet at utilities and small industrial sites. The flaw was added to CISA's Known Exploited Vulnerabilities catalog on 2023-12-11, indicating confirmed exploitation in the wild, and CISA has urged water facilities to secure their Unitronics PLCs.

Do: Upgrade to VisiLogic 9.9.00 or later and set a strong, unique administrative password on every Vision/Samba device. Restrict network access to affected devices (firewall or VPN rather than direct internet exposure) and review device logs for unexpected administrative logins. Per the CISA KEV required action, apply mitigations per vendor instructions or discontinue use of the product if mitigations are unavailable.

An exploitable vulnerability exists in the object stream parsing functionality of Nitro Software, Inc.’s Nitro Pro 13.13.2.242 when updating its cross-reference

An exploitable vulnerability exists in the object stream parsing functionality of Nitro Software, Inc.’s Nitro Pro 13.13.2.242 when updating its cross-reference table. When processing an object stream from a PDF document, the application will perform a calculation in order to allocate memory for the list of indirect objects. Due to an error when calculating this size, an integer overflow may occur which can result in an undersized buffer being allocated. Later when initializing this buffer, the application can write outside its bounds which can cause a memory corruption that can lead to code execution. A specially crafted document can be delivered to a victim in order to trigger this vulnerability.

An exploitable code execution vulnerability exists in the rendering functionality of Nitro Pro 13.13.2.242 and 13.16.2.300.

An exploitable code execution vulnerability exists in the rendering functionality of Nitro Pro 13.13.2.242 and 13.16.2.300. When drawing the contents of a page and selecting the stroke color from an 'ICCBased' colorspace, the application will read a length from the file and use it as a loop sentinel when writing data into the member of an object. Due to the object member being a buffer of a static size allocated on the heap, this can result in a heap-based buffer overflow. A specially crafted document must be loaded by a victim in order to trigger this vulnerability.
